Clues

Walk distance: about 1/3 mile one way.
Trail difficulty: fairly easy; however, the dirt road is steep in some sections.
Stamp hand-carved.
Status: alive and well on September 11, 2009

I have a "granddog" named Sierra. Her family asked me to hide a letterbox in her honor.

From U. S. Highway 50 in Placerville, drive north on State Highway 49 for about 3.5 miles to the intersection with Red Shack Road. There is a dirt pullout on the right side of this intersection with a bronze historical marker for "The Luse Ditch Flume". Continue through the pullout to a separate fenced parking area at the far end of the pullout and park there.

Walk through the gate and on the dirt road that goes downhill. Walk until you arrive at a sharp hairpin turn to the left. At this turn there is a narrow side trail going off to the right. There is a bunch of wild grape growing at this intersection. Walk on the side trail for about 109 steps to where the trail appears to end in a small clearing. Turn to your right and go for about 90 degrees (from mag. north) up slope for about 34 steps to a fairly large double trunk Oak Tree with a very leaning Pine Tree several yards behind it. The box is under the east side of the Oak Tree covered with some rocks covered with some plant debris. Be alert for snakes.
